Least Common Multiple of 81223 and 81238 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 81223 and 81238, than apply into the LCM equation.

GCF(81223,81238) = 1
LCM(81223,81238) = ( 81223 × 81238) / 1
LCM(81223,81238) = 6598394074 / 1
LCM(81223,81238) = 6598394074
